According to the public record, 22, Outram Close, Hull is a mid-century apartment with 559 ft2 of internal area.
Apartments of this size in this area normally have 2 bedrooms.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 22, Outram Close, Hull is £104,134 and the estimated rental value is £728 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 22, Outram Close, Hull is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£109,341 and a rental value of £764 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£96,845 and a rental value of £677 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of 22 Outram Close Hull has decreased by an estimated £1,248 (1.2%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£21 per month (2.9%), giving an expected gross yield of 8.4%.
22, Outram Close, Hull has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 17 Feb 2025.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.

Outram Close, Hull, HU2 has a total of 30 addresses. According to our analysis of all the public data, 22, Outram Close, Hull is the 11th largest and the 11th most expensive property on the street.
When compared to the postcode district it is £1k more expensive than the average property in HU2.
The closest station to 22, Outram Close, Hull is Hull station which is 800 metres away.
According to recent data from Ofcom, ultrafast broadband is available in this area.
According to recent data from Ofcom, Ultrafast broadband is available in the area.
According to data from the Environment Agency, the flood risk in this area is considered to be very low.
The recent census recorded whether a resident owned or rented their home.
In the area around 22, Outram Close, Hull, 58.0% of property is socially rented and 23.2% is privately rented.
